There are many variables that determine how successful you are
with your Web site or affiliate program. However, the IT News Research
Team has found some common ingredients that contribute to success
(not in any particular order):
1. Your Web Site must have a purpose or focus - why is it there?
Is it serving a useful need? A site that provides *relevant* information,
products or services gets a good start.
2. Many sites exist simply to put up 5 or 10 banners per page trying
to make a quick buck. They don't. Visitors leave the site before
the page loads. A good site focuses on serving its readers needs.
Let readers provide you with feedback. This way, our readers help
us improve our site all the time.
3. Design is important - that means if you can get your information
across without 20k fancy graphics, don't worry about the graphics.
Ease of navigation is vital - visitors come to your site for a purpose
- and they want to locate the relevant information quickly. You
might only get 3 or 4 mouse clicks to deliver what your reader wants.
If you fail, he or she goes elsewhere.
4. If you are selling a product or service, this should be obvious
from your Front Page - like a Buy Button or Link. If you sell more
than 2 or 3 items, an Index to the products is essential. Readers
can then rapidly select what they want.
5. "Content is King" - if a product complements your content,
readers are more likely to find it interesting. Provide relevant
links, descriptions or reviews wherever possible.
You need to select reputable programs - and top products or services.
6. Regular updates - both via your web site and newsletters.
7. Web Site Promotion - people need to know your site exists. Submit
your pages to the top search engines; newsletters are excellent
- you are reading one!; exchange links with relevant Web sites;
advertising your site is important. You have to spend money to make
money.
8. Give readers a good reason to come to your site regularly -
and they may buy from you. We provide research centers and resources.
We also run competitions and prize draws.
9. We create partnerships whereby everyone involved wins - our
readers, our suppliers, our company, the community.
10. Our Team constantly ask the following questions about our site:
If this wasn't our site, would we find it very useful on a regular
basis; would we recommend it to our friends; would we suggest any
improvements; what do we like about the site; what do we dislike.
And More questions. Our readers give us excellent feedback.
